Description

Description

1-Bromo-2,4-dinitrobenzene has been used in the preparation of 2,4-dinitrophenol via treatment with KO2-crown ether complex in benzene. It is used as substrate in protein determination and glutathione S-transferase (GST) assay of chicken and rat prostaglandin D2 synthase (PGDS).

Solubility
Soluble in water (partly miscible).

Notes
Store in cool, dry conditions in a sealed container. Incompatible with oxidizing agents.

Safety and Handling

Safety and Handling

GHS H Statement
H302-H312-H315-H319-H317-H335
Harmful if swallowed.
Harmful in contact with skin.
Causes skin irritation.
Causes serious eye irritation.
May cause an allergic skin reaction.
May cause respiratory irritation.
